Cap-Net resource for IWRM

The United Nations Development Programme (UNDP)and the Global Water Partnership, an international network of organizations involved in water resources management, developed a useful web site as part of the programme of the International Network for Capacity Building in IWRM (Cap-Net). The site contains training materials and tools for learning about integrated water resources management, including links to publications and an online tutorial that can be used in workshops. The tutorial and other training materials are also available in CDROM format.

The first phase of the Cap-Net project, development of regional and country networks, including the southern African WaterNet, was completed in December 2005. Cap-Net has new funding from the EU and UNDP and will focus on implementation of water management principles.
